What Is Included in a Move In Clean?
Every property is different, but a move in cleaning service usually targets the areas most likely to affect comfort and hygiene. The aim is to help you walk in and feel confident that the property is ready for occupation. For many customers, that means removing the final layer of dust and residue left behind after the previous occupancy, maintenance work, or the moving process itself.
Typical tasks often include deep dust removal, surface cleaning, sanitising, and detailed attention to the kitchen and bathroom. A good service is usually more thorough than a standard tidy-up because move-in conditions often require more than a quick wipe. It should also be flexible enough to suit your property size, the number of rooms, and any special priorities you have before unpacking.
In practical terms, move in cleans commonly cover the following:
- Cleaning inside and outside accessible kitchen cupboards and drawers
- Wiping worktops, splashbacks, and visible surface areas
- Cleaning sinks, taps, and fittings
- Degreasing kitchen surfaces where needed
- Cleaning bathrooms, including toilets, basins, showers, baths, and tiles
- Dusting skirting boards, shelves, ledges, and reachable fixtures
- Vacuuming and mopping floors
- Cleaning internal glass and reachable mirrors
- Removing visible marks from doors and handles
- Refreshing high-touch points throughout the property

Areas of the Property That Often Need Extra Attention
Even when a property looks acceptable at first glance, certain areas often reveal hidden dirt or residue once you look more closely. These are the places that can affect how comfortable and hygienic your move feels. A good move in cleaning service pays attention to those often-missed details.
Kitchens
Kitchens are usually the most important room to clean thoroughly before moving in. Cupboards may contain dust, crumbs, or shelf residue, while sinks, taps, appliances, and worktops may need sanitising. If the property has been empty for a while, grease build-up or stale odours can also be an issue. A proper clean helps make food preparation safer and more pleasant from day one.
Bathrooms
Bathrooms need careful cleaning because they are high-use hygiene spaces. Toilets, basins, showers, baths, tiles, and fittings should all be cleaned so the room feels genuinely ready. In shared homes or rental properties, this is especially important because the bathroom is often the first place people notice whether a property has been cleaned properly.
Living spaces, bedrooms, and hallways
These areas may not require the same intensive treatment as kitchens and bathrooms, but they still matter. Dust on skirting boards, marks on doors, and debris in corners can affect the overall impression of the property. Vacuuming, mopping, and detailed dusting help create a comfortable, move-in-ready environment.

Preparation Checklist Before Your Cleaning Appointment
To make the most of your move in cleaning in Battersea, a little preparation helps the team work efficiently and ensures they can focus on the cleaning itself. You do not need to overcomplicate it; the main aim is simply to make access clear and avoid unnecessary delays.
Here is a practical checklist to consider before the appointment:
- Make sure the property is accessible at the arranged time
- Confirm whether the home or office will be empty during the clean
- Remove personal valuables and any fragile items
- Let the cleaner know about any areas requiring special attention
- Check whether parking or entry instructions need to be arranged in advance
- If relevant, ensure utilities such as water and electricity are available
- Keep pets and children safely away from active cleaning areas
When possible, it is also helpful to decide what matters most to you before the clean begins. For example, you may want the kitchen prioritised first, or perhaps the bathrooms are your main concern. Sharing those preferences in advance helps the service feel more personal and efficient.
Pricing Factors to Consider
Customers often want to understand what influences the cost of a move in clean, even when exact prices are not listed online. That is a sensible question, because move in cleaning is usually priced according to the size of the property, the amount of work involved, and the specific condition of the space.
Several factors can affect the final quote:
- Number of bedrooms, bathrooms, and reception rooms
- Whether the property is empty, partially furnished, or fully furnished
- Condition of kitchens and bathrooms
- Whether the property has been vacant, renovated, or recently used
- Need for inside cupboard, appliance, or detailed fixture cleaning
- Access requirements such as stairs, lifts, or restricted entry
- Whether the service is for a home, rental property, or commercial premises
